Hi all, I'm either confused about dev.prev() or there's a bug in it. Open two devices, plot a plot, call dev.prev() and plot again. I would expect the second plot to appear in the first device, but that is not what happens; both plots appear in the second device. Is this expected behavior or a bug? Example (in linux):
